Fly Fishing Film Festival in Boone, NC 4-27 benefiting MountainTrue and the Watauga Riverkeeper

April 27 @ 6:00 pm - 10:00 pm

The 2025 International Fly Fishing Film Festival, sponsored by Boone’s Fly Shop and benefiting MountainTrue and the Watauga Riverkeeper, is coming to the Appalachian Theatre of the High Country on Sunday, April 27th.

IF4™ is the world’s leading fly-fishing film event, consisting of films produced by professional filmmakers from all corners of the globe and showcases the passion, lifestyle, and culture of fly fishing. It is the gathering place of the fly-fishing community and a celebration of friendship, fly-fishing stories and stoke.

This year’s event kicks off with a pre-screening concert performance with Mad Tom & The Chubs from 6 to 7 PM. The film festival film screening begins at 7 PM.
